This paper presents a revision of the status of current standards dedicated to mobile services systems, using combined satellite and terrestrial components transmission. The objective is the analysis of a hybrid system compatible with DVB-SH and SDR technologies, taking as a basis the work and studies performed in MOVISAT project.
This paper introduces the standardization work on C2P (Connection Control Protocol), carried on in the frame of ETSI SES BSM working group. As a first step, this work has defined a C2P solution for dynamic connectivity and QoS control in all types of DVB-RCS satellite networks.

Satellite systems are playing a key role like access network in the provision of next generation services. New concepts in the payloads architectures are required in order to support efficiently the new multimedia services. This paper will present the study of next generation payload architecture (in the context of Satsix project), taking into account the impact over different system scenarios.
